Senseonics Holdings (SENS) Misses Q4 EPS by 2c, Revenues Beat; Offers FY20 Revenue Guidance Below Consensus
March 12, 2020 4:33 PM EDTSenseonics Holdings (NYSE: SENS) reported Q4 EPS of ($0.18), $0.02 worse than the analyst estimate of ($0.16). Revenue for the quarter came in at $9 million versus the consensus estimate of $8.07 million.
Fourth Quarter total net revenue of $9.0 million
OUS net revenue of $8.1 millionU.S. net revenue of $0.8 million after accounting for gross to net reductions, primarily related to the Eversense® Bridge ProgramU.S. gross revenue was $2.5 million.
